Sand Goons | Northwest Arkansas Commercial Photography
Today on the blog: Recent work for Sand Goons USA, a lifestyle brand aimed at people who love sand sports. Sand Goons USA is the brain child of Nate Allen, an avid lover and participant in sand sports. And in case you can’t tell from the pictures, sand sports consists of driving things (usually dirt bikes, 4 wheelers and ATVS) really fast through desert sands. This photoshoot was another classic example of why commercial photography continues to be a favorite; Not only were we able to create some super fun content, but we were able to learn about and experience another sport and its surrounding culture.
